WebAbstract Given any abelian group G, the generalized dihedral group of G is the semi-direct product of C 2 = {±1} and G, denoted D(G) = C 2 n ϕ G. The homomorphism ϕ maps C 2 to the automorphism group of G, providing an action on G by inverting elements. WebThe dihedral group D5 of isometries of a regular pentagon has elements {e, r, r^2, r^3, r^4, x, rx, r^2x, r^3x, r^4x } where r is a rotation by angle 2π/5 and x, rx, r^2x, r^3x, r^4x are the five possible reflections. The multiplication table is determined by the fact that r has order 5, x has order 2 and xr = r^4x. WebThe dihedral group D n is the group of symmetries of a regular polygon with nvertices.
